TNDM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2026 in Review
272 of the 8,126 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Tandem Diabetes Care (TNDM) for Q1 2026, worth a combined $1.51B — down 8.4% from $1.65B a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 45 funds opened new TNDM positions and 35 closed out — a net gain of 10 holders — while 94 added to existing stakes and 93 trimmed.
The largest buyer was UBS Group, adding an estimated $35.4M. The largest seller was Assenagon Asset Management, cutting an estimated $22.8M.
